Whale Activity and Market Dynamics

The role of whale activity cannot be understated in the context of cryptocurrency markets, particularly Ethereum. The recent uptick in whale activity has shed light on the underlying market dynamics that could influence Ethereum’s future trajectory. For instance, one prominent whale recently withdrew 5,000 ETH from Kraken and subsequently used these funds as collateral to borrow $7 million in USDS. The borrowed amount was then utilized to purchase additional ETH at an average price of $1,518 per token. This series of transactions indicates not only a sophisticated trading strategy but also a strong belief in the potential appreciation of Ethereum. Crypto analysts, such as Ali Martinez, have highlighted important trends that suggest Ethereum might be undervalued. The entity-adjusted dormancy flow for Ethereum has fallen below 1 million, a figure that historically signals macro bottom zones. Such indicators often hint at potential buying opportunities, contradicting the broader market sentiment of recent times. Diminished selling activity among long-term holders further supports the narrative of Ethereum’s possible undervaluation, providing a counterpoint to the prevailing uncertainty.
